Buying Guide: Tire Pressure Sensor For Motorcycle
Understanding the Importance of a Tire Pressure Sensor
When I first started riding my motorcycle regularly, I realized how crucial maintaining proper tire pressure is for safety and performance. A tire pressure sensor helps me keep track of my tire pressure in real time, preventing unexpected flats and improving fuel efficiency. Knowing this, investing in a reliable sensor became a priority.
Types of Motorcycle Tire Pressure Sensors
There are mainly two types of tire pressure sensors I encountered: direct and indirect. Direct sensors measure the actual pressure inside the tire via a valve-mounted device, giving precise readings. Indirect sensors estimate pressure by monitoring wheel speed or other parameters but are less accurate. I personally prefer direct sensors for their accuracy and reliability.
Compatibility with Your Motorcycle
Before purchasing a sensor, I made sure it was compatible with my motorcycle’s make and model. Some sensors are universal, while others are designed for specific brands or tire valve types. Checking the product specifications and my bike’s requirements helped me avoid compatibility issues.
Installation Process
I looked for sensors that offered easy installation, preferably ones that I could install myself without professional help. Some sensors require removing the tire, while others are simpler to attach to the valve stem. Considering my mechanical skills, I chose a sensor with a straightforward installation process to save time and cost.
Display and Monitoring Options
Monitoring tire pressure is essential, so I evaluated how each sensor displays information. Some come with a dedicated handheld monitor, while others connect to a smartphone app via Bluetooth. I opted for a sensor with a convenient display option that allowed me to check tire pressure quickly while on the road.
Battery Life and Maintenance
Battery life was another factor I considered. Sensors with long-lasting batteries reduce the hassle of frequent replacements. Some sensors have replaceable batteries, while others are sealed units. I preferred models where battery maintenance was straightforward to ensure continuous monitoring.
Durability and Weather Resistance
Since motorcycles are exposed to various weather conditions, I chose a sensor that is waterproof and resistant to dust and debris. Durability ensures the sensor will function properly even during rain or extreme temperatures, giving me peace of mind on every ride.
Price and Warranty
Finally, I compared prices to find a sensor that fit my budget without compromising quality. A good warranty period also helped me feel secure in my investment, knowing the manufacturer stands behind their product.
